Why this keeps happening
The lack of clear communication and understanding of payment terms is a common issue in the voice over industry. Without a professional contract in place, clients may not take your business seriously, leading to misunderstandings and missed payments. Invoicing too late can also cause delays in payment, and not having a system for tracking payments can result in lost revenue.

How to implement this step by step
Create a Professional Contract
A professional contract is essential for establishing clear expectations with clients and protecting your business. When creating a contract, be sure to include payment terms, rates, and delivery dates. Consider using a template or hiring a lawyer to ensure your contract is comprehensive and enforceable. For example, if you're working on a commercial, your contract should include details on the number of revisions allowed, the delivery date, and the payment terms. This will help prevent misunderstandings and ensure timely payments.
Use a Payment Link on Your Invoice
Using a payment link on your invoice makes it easy for clients to pay online and reduces the risk of lost checks or declined payments. This can be especially useful for international clients or those who prefer to pay by credit card. When creating a payment link, make sure to include the payment amount, due date, and any relevant payment instructions. You can also set up automatic reminders to follow up with clients and ensure timely payments.
Set Clear Deadlines for Payment
Setting clear deadlines for payment is essential for ensuring timely payments and reducing financial stress. When working with clients, be sure to establish a clear payment schedule and communicate it clearly. Consider using a project management tool to track progress and communicate effectively with clients throughout the project. For example, if you're working on a commercial, you could set a payment deadline of 14 days after delivery. This will give you time to review the project and ensure timely payment.
Use a Digital Invoicing Tool
Using a digital invoicing tool can automate the invoicing process, send reminders, and track payments in one place. This can be especially useful for freelancers or small businesses who need to manage multiple clients and projects. When choosing a digital invoicing tool, look for one that integrates with your project management tool and offers features such as automatic reminders, payment tracking, and customizable invoices.
Consider Retainer-Based Pricing
Consider offering retainer-based pricing to secure recurring revenue and reduce the financial stress of feast-or-famine project work. This can be especially useful for clients who require ongoing services, such as voice over work for a podcast or video series. When creating a retainer agreement, be sure to include details on the scope of work, payment terms, and any relevant metrics for measuring success. This will help establish clear expectations with clients and ensure timely payments.
